What is Remote Play?

Remote play allows you to play PlayStation games on your console without needing to be physically nearby. With the PS app, you can access and control your console from devices connected to the internet.

How to Enable Remote Play on PS app: Step-by-Step Instructions

Step 1: Download and Install PS Remote Play App

  • Go to the App Store on your device (iPhone/iPad or Android) or Steam on your PC.
  • Search for "PS Remote Play" and download it for free.
  • Sign in with your PlayStation account (PSN) before the installation process begins.
  • Follow the on-screen instructions to complete the setup process.

Step 2: Set Up your Console

  • Make sure your PS4 or PS5 console is turned on and connected to the internet via Wi-Fi or an Ethernet cable.
  • Press the PS button on your DualShock controller to wake it up.
  • Log in to your PS account to ensure you are ready for remote play.

Step 3: Select Console

  • Open the PS app on your mobile device or PC.
  • Select the "Console" icon from the top of the screen.
  • Find and select your PS console in the list of connected consoles.

Step 4: Start Remote Play

  • Once you are logged in and your console is selected, you should be able to start Remote Play.
  • Click or tap the "Start Streaming" button to begin broadcasting gameplay from your console.

Tips and Tricks:

  • Stabilize your Connection: Maintain a stable internet connection to ensure smooth gameplay. A wireless network may not be sufficient; consider using an Ethernet cable for a more secure and stable connection.
  • Adjust Video Quality Settings: Adjust video quality to achieve the best balance between frame rate and resolution based on your internet connection speeds.
  • Use Mobile Optimized Controls: Change to mobile-optimized controls within the PS app to streamline gaming on smaller screens.
  • Keep your Devices Connected: Ensure both your device and console are connected and authorized to use Remote Play.
  • Update to Latest Firmware: Regularly update your console and mobile devices to ensure compatibility with the latest Remote Play feature enhancements.

Troubleshooting Common Issues:

  • Connection Issues: Ensure your internet connection is stable and try restarting both devices.
  • No Connection Found: Check for authentication issues or ensure console settings are correct.
  • Audio Issues: Toggle off and on audio effects, or adjust audio levels in the PS app to fix audio issues.
